Eggless Mawa Cake
Recipe# 39330
05 May 14

 by Dip's Diner
No reviews
Here is a rich, eggless dessert that is very soft, moist and delicious. In this recipe curd is used to replace eggs and there is no use of baking powder. The measurements in this recipe are provided in grams. Cup measurements may cause the results to vary.
